How much do bi production works j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for bi production works in the United States is $16.61,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.90 and $17.79 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is BI Production Works?

BI Production Works refers to the processes and activities involved in managing, operating, and maintaining Business Intelligence (BI) systems in a live, production environment. These roles typically ensure that BI tools, dashboards, reports, and data pipelines are functioning correctly, up-to-date, and accessible to stakeholders. BI Production Works professionals are responsible for monitoring system performance, troubleshooting issues, and implementing updates or enhancements to support business decision-making. Their work is crucial in ensuring data reliability, security, and optimal performance for business analytics.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a BI Production Works professional, and why are they important?

To thrive in BI Production Works, you need a solid background in data analysis, SQL, and business intelligence concepts, typically supported by a degree in computer science, information systems, or a related field. Familiarity with BI tools such as Microsoft Power BI, Tableau, or SAP BusinessObjects, as well as data warehousing and ETL processes, is crucial.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ication set top professionals apart in this role. These skills ensure accurate data delivery, support informed business decisions, and enable efficient collaboration across departments.

R159035 BI Developer- Research Analytics (Open)How You'll Help Transform Healthcare:
The Business Intelligence Developer I works within a challenging, integrated analytics and reporting environment delivering clinical, financial, operational and research intelligence essential for decision making based on role and workflow.
Remote Work position. Candidates residing in the following states can be considered for remote work: Alabama, Florida, Georgia, Arkansas, Kentucky, Louisiana, Mississippi, North Carolina, South Carolina, Tennessee, West Virginia, and Virginia.
  • Works with Epic and non-Epic tools, content, data sources, processes and distribution methods to provide actionable information. Prepares reports and dashboards for internal and external clients to assist with making business decisions. Uses best practices for appropriate tools, products, and client access.
  • Utilizes necessary tools to prepare reports and databases to create products of minor complexity or moderate complexity with supervision.
  • Ensures completeness, correctness and consistency of data and data structure.
  • Ensures secure and high integrity data integration. Responsible for coordinating validation and ensuring that solutions are appropriately tested and meet end user workflow.
  • This position will work closely with leaders, end-users, statistical programmers, and other technical staff to provide data acquisition, analysis, reporting, consulting and training.
  • Participates in all phases of software lifecycle development, particularly in the reporting analysis, development, testing documentation and implementation.
  • Adheres to Change Management policies and processes to include timely reporting of all pertinent change information, effective discussion of the changes, internal and external communications, contingency planning, support of the change event and post-change reporting.
  • May work with clients to identify technical requirements.
  • Documents and maintains documentation of products including functional summaries, diagrams, flow charts or other documentation as needed.
  • Provides reporting and analytic product client use and upgrade support.
  • Assists with automating manual processes.
  • Establishes and creates a positive project team environment through collaboration.
  • Delivers solutions to business function end-users from design to performance and support.
  • Adheres to enterprise technical and design standards.
  • Completes multiple assignments within a given timeframe.
  • Identifies and resolves customer issues. May need to escalate issues to appropriate leadership.
  • Completes annual professional development and required in-service education.
  • Seeks out guidance and assistance from higher level resources as task complexity warrants.
What We Require:
Education: Bachelor's degree required, or relevant work experience can be used in lieu of degree. Master's degree or PhD in a field indicating complex analytical thinking may be used in lieu of experience.
Experience: Minimum of 1 year of experience with relational databases and data management required. Reporting experience is required. Experience using Epic, SAP, and/or other business intelligence reporting tools required. Experience with benchmarking and/or data visualization tools strongly preferred. Experience and understanding of documentation, change control, and maintenance procedures as they apply to reporting and analytic products. Healthcare information technology experience preferred.
Other Minimum Qualifications: Strong listening skills, ability to work independently and as part of a team, ability to understand and apply specification requirements to reporting and analytic tool development. Excellent verbal and written communication skills and interpersonal skills are required. Detail oriented, strong analytical, organizational, and problem-solving skills. Ability to analyze, diagnose, suggest and implement process modifications. Strong customer service orientation and ability to follow through issues to resolution. Ability to interact with people from all organizational levels and build consensus through negotiation and diplomacy. Ability to be flexible, versatile and adaptable in day-to-day activities.
